Stopped in here on a Saturday afternoon for a bite for lunch since we were in the area. First time visitors so we didn’t know what to expect. Glad we did — around 50 beers on tap, Pens game was just coming on, we had a BOGO coupon,…life couldn’t get any better. We each had a burger — she had the Belgian, a super flavorful lamb burger(done medium well), while I had the Piggy Bac — a mix of ground infused bacon. Both were delish! We had asked our server who happened to be the bartender as well — [I think her name was Megan(covered in tats)] — if they could cut each burger in half so we could share. They did so, and served them with a half on each plate — how accommodating! The burgers came«naked» with just what was mentioned on the menu on them. We thought this was a little odd,…then they brought out the fresh condiments on a separate cold plate so they wouldn’t get soggy. Mine came with some fresh cut fries — eat these quick or they’ll start to wilt. My «date» swapped out her fires for a cup of the red pepper bisque — that was a really good decision. For the beer, we decided to go with the $ 15 taster rack; four 5.5 oz glasses of any draft you want. Not a bad one in the bunch. Once delivered, Megan(who was also super knowledgeable about the beer) recommended going from the light to dark so as to not screw up our palates; the ice water helped cleanse them as well. They also have a «mystery brew» — $ 4.50 for a mason jar of a mystery beer. Maybe next time. All in all, a good day. After the BOGO and the tip, about $ 40 considering that $ 15 was for beer. Big question — would I go back? ABSOLUTLEY! More to try on both menus.

This is one of my boyfriend’s favorite places to go to catch a steeler’s or pens game. Typically we sit at the bar-always decent service. I can now say I’ve tried every variety of mussels they have(mussels from Brussels, over the edge, basil and wine with garlic, and spicy sriracha). My favorite is the first one I tried there, the mussels from Brussels. The Sriracha is a little spicy for my taste but this last time the server offered bread for dipping and I’ll say that was the best sauce for dipping with bread. I’ve also had the buffalo bites in the jerk BBQ sauce and it was perfect-not too spicy, just enough flavor… these were nice boneless wings. I’ve also had the same variety of sauce with bone-in wings and I personally prefer the boneless-less messy obviously. I still want to try some of the sandwiches and maybe the french onion soup so I’ll have to update again once I do that.
